Transaction 75710623a88f3072bfc5d8ea309be559553709ee3f132e6f9c4fa354642122bd
1 Input
1 Output
-
75710623a88f3072bfc5d8ea309be559553709ee3f132e6f9c4fa354642122bd:0
- value
- 215561
- script pubkey
- OP_0 OP_PUSHBYTES_20 faf1d3d702453ba582609549eae011bbf2d73bbc
- address
- bc1qltca84czg5a6tqnqj4y74cq3h0edwwauadhhgl